Forum CIO are recruiting for a Community Resilience Co-ordinator to join our Sector Support NEL team.
Salary: £30,855 pro rata (£25,018 actual)
Hours: 30 hours per week
We are seeking a proactive and collaborative professional to work alongside Voluntary, Community and Social Enterprise (VCSE) organisations across North East Lincolnshire. The role focuses on strengthening local provision that supports people in crisis, such as food and advice services, and builds community resilience. You will work strategically with partners, facilitate collaboration, support organisational development, improve data and reporting systems, and communicate local provision effectively. The post also involves partnership working with the local authority, reporting outcomes to funders, and representing the programme locally.
What is important to us is:
* Experience of working with VCSE or community organisations and an understanding of the challenges they face
* The ability to build strong partnerships, communicate clearly and influence a wide range of stakeholders
* Confidence in coordinating projects, managing information and using data to demonstrate impact
* A values‑led approach, with a commitment to equality and inclusion and the ability to work independently and as part of a team
